## Audit Checklist — Item 7: Color Contrast

Run the contrast pass on the Dunesweep dashboard before sign-off. Check every text/background pairing against the 4.5:1 minimum (3:1 for large text), including hover and disabled states — the disabled buttons failed last quarter, so don't skip those. Log failures in the audit sheet with screenshots. If anything's borderline, don't guess; escalate. The person who owns this audit item is below.

account owner for tawef-yadug: Jorius Normir Silath

From: R. Castellan, Director of Operations
To: P. Imbry, Director of People

For the board: training budget draft sits at last year's level plus 4%. Leadership programme at the Fennwick Institute renewed; technical certifications for the Orvale plant deferred pending headcount review. Unspent Q4 funds roll into the onboarding track. Approvals queue is clear except two cross-border course requests. Board paper is drafted; figures reconciled with finance Tuesday. The strategic driver behind the uplift is set out directly below.

board note of kageg-bahof: The renewal with Holwynax Holdings closes at $2 million a year, 5 percent below the last contract. Project Ulaath slips by two quarters because of the supplier delay.

## Tuning

The Hartwell pick-list optimizer balances walk distance against order urgency, and its behavior is sensitive to a handful of weights. If you are on call and pickers report zig-zag routes or stale batches, adjust conservatively: change one value at a time, redeploy to the Millgate canary zone, and watch the route-length histogram for fifteen minutes before rolling wider. All weights live in `optimizer/config.py`. The defaults shipped with release 4.2 are shown here:

tuning table, bagep-tahof:
RATE_LIMITS = {
    "ralael": 10,
    "druath": 5,
}

// REINDEX_BATCH_CAP limits docs per shard pass in the Tallowfield
// nightly search reindex. Raising it starves the ingest queue;
// lowering it overruns the maintenance window. 5000 is the tested
// sweet spot. Change only with a soak run. Verified against the
// build noted below.

session token of bawif-hahog = htk6_ac5981